Photoelectric switches represent a fundamental component in modern industrial automation, and the CL34-2413GH model stands out as a reliable and versatile solution for diverse sensing needs. This device operates on the principle of light beam interruption or reflection to detect the presence, absence, or position of objects without physical contact. The CL34-2413GH typically features a compact housing, making it suitable for installation in space-constrained environments. Its construction often involves durable materials that provide resistance to dust, moisture, and mechanical impacts, ensuring consistent performance in harsh industrial settings.

The CL34-2413GH photoelectric switch is commonly available in different sensing modes, including through-beam, retro-reflective, and diffuse reflective configurations. In through-beam mode, the transmitter and receiver are separate units, allowing for long-range detection and high accuracy. Retro-reflective mode uses a reflector to bounce the light back to the receiver, offering a practical balance between range and setup simplicity. Diffuse reflective mode relies on the target object itself to reflect light, making it ideal for detecting objects at close distances without additional components. This flexibility enables the CL34-2413GH to adapt to various applications, from conveyor belt monitoring to packaging machinery.

Key technical specifications of the CL34-2413GH include its sensing distance, response time, and output type. Sensing distance can vary based on the mode, with through-beam versions often supporting ranges up to several meters. A fast response time, typically in the millisecond range, allows for high-speed detection in dynamic processes. The switch may offer digital outputs such as NPN or PNP transistors, facilitating easy integration with programmable logic controllers (PLCs) and other control systems. Additionally, many models incorporate adjustable sensitivity settings, enabling users to fine-tune detection parameters to avoid false triggers from environmental factors like ambient light or background interference.

Installation and wiring of the CL34-2413GH are straightforward, with clear markings for power supply, output, and ground connections. A standard voltage range, such as 10-30V DC, ensures compatibility with common industrial power sources. Proper alignment is crucial for optimal performance, especially in through-beam and retro-reflective modes, where misalignment can lead to reduced sensing reliability. Mounting brackets or threaded barrels are often included to secure the switch in place, and LED indicators provide visual feedback on power status and detection events, aiding in troubleshooting and maintenance.

In practical applications, the CL34-2413GH photoelectric switch excels in scenarios requiring non-contact sensing. For example, in manufacturing lines, it can count products, detect jams, or verify component placement. In material handling systems, it monitors the position of goods on pallets or triggers automated gates. The switch's robustness also makes it suitable for outdoor use, such as in vehicle detection for parking facilities or security systems. By preventing mechanical wear and tear associated with contact-based switches, the CL34-2413GH enhances system longevity and reduces maintenance costs.

When selecting a photoelectric switch like the CL34-2413GH, consider factors such as the operating environment, target object properties, and required precision. For dusty or humid areas, models with higher ingress protection (IP) ratings are advisable. Transparent or shiny objects may require specialized sensors with polarized filters to ensure accurate detection. Regular calibration and cleaning of the lens can maintain performance over time, as dirt accumulation may attenuate the light beam. Comparing datasheets from manufacturers helps identify the best variant for specific needs, as features like temperature tolerance and housing material can differ.
